Multnomah County Online Voters' Guide
November 2008 General Election

CITY OF FAIRVIEW - City Council Position #1

Balwant Bhullar

BALWANT BHULLAR

OCCUPATION: Small business owner from the last 6 years in Fairview , OR ; Minit Mart (2007-2008); Fairview Chevron Gas station and convinience store(2004- present); Fairview Subs(recently opened)

OCCUPATIONAL BACKGROUND: owned a trucking company from 1993-1996 (eighteen wheelers); Other jobs in California , cashier in convienence stores, farm worker; construction work in electrical field

EDUCATIONAL BACKGROUND: high school,Electrical engineering diploma, Criminal & Justice: just shy of a AA; certified fingerprint classifier; law enforcement training completed

PRIOR GOVERNMENTAL EXPERIENCE: Member of Fairview Park Committee; Member of Fairview Police Chief Advisory Committee

I will commit myself-
to keep a clean and friendly environment in the city of Fairview
to keep schools, parks, and streets in Fairview safe
to promote and support business's and bring the city and business's together in a team which makes us better as a community.
to create ideas for more fun activities for kids.

Endorsement By

  1. Theresa Davis, Reynold's School Board Member
  2. Paz Ramos
  3. Mike Weatherby Mayor City of Fairview

 

(This information furnished by Balwant Bhullar)
